
This comparison is for buyers deciding between a feature-rich wireless keyboard and a straightforward wired compact board. The Ajazz AK870 offers modern conveniences like a screen and tri-mode connectivity, while the Machenike K500 provides a traditional, space-saving layout. The choice is difficult because both are hot-swappable and offer good value, but they cater to fundamentally different user priorities regarding connectivity and desk space.

Your primary need dictates the choice. If wireless freedom, multi-device connectivity, and modern features like a screen and gasket mount are priorities, the Ajazz AK870 is the clear selection. If you need a simple, affordable, wired keyboard with a compact layout that includes a numpad, and prefer to spend less, the Machenike K500 is a competent option. Consider the AK870 an investment in features and the K500 a value-focused tool.
The Ajazz AK870 is the more versatile choice, winning for office use, travel, modding, and content creation due to its wireless features, gasket mount design, and customizable screen. The Machenike K500 takes the lead for gaming, specifically citing NKRO support. For programming, it's a tie, as both offer durable PBT keycaps and hot-swap sockets, leaving the decision to layout preference between TKL and 96%.
